Peter Hart Lawson
« on: Tuesday 12 January 16 15:17 GMT (UK) »
I am looking for any info on Peter Hart Lawson born in Paisley on 16/4/1898 to Peter and Mary Lawson (nee McMillan). He does not appear in the 1901 or 1911 census. Next appearance on any certificates is a marriage to Annie McSporran on 5/8/1919. His is listed as a miner. Banns read at Bargaeddie Parish Church. He died on 7/3/1960. He 3 or 4 children. The death certificate was signed by E. Hunter his son in law. Peter Hart Lawson would have been my uncle and he is a missing link in the family history that I am in the progress of doing.
